The 1984–85 Northern Premier League season was the 17th in the history of the Northern Premier League, a football competition in England.

Overview

The League featured twenty-two clubs.

Cup Results

Challenge Cup:

  • Marine bt. Goole Town

President's Cup:

  • Rhyl 2–0 Macclesfield Town

Northern Premier League Shield: Between Champions of NPL Premier Division and Winners of the NPL Cup.

  • Stafford Rangers bt. Marine

End of the season

At the end of the seventeenth season of the Northern Premier League, Stafford Rangers applied to join the Alliance Premier League and were successful.
